Entry requirements for an 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ments may vary depending on the institution offering the program. However, typical entry requirements for such a course may include:

  1. Age Requirement: Applicants must be at least 16 years old at the time of enrollment.
  2. Educational Background: A minimum of a Level 1 qualification or equivalent is recommended. Basic literacy and numeracy skills are essential for understanding course materials and assessments.
  3. Interest in Beauty Therapy: A keen interest in the beauty and wellness industry is expected, as this course is designed for individuals passionate about developing a career in beauty treatments.
  4. Health and Fitness: Applicants should be in good health to perform physical tasks and demonstrate practical skills required in beauty therapy.
  5. English Proficiency: Non-native English speakers may need to demonstrate proficiency in English, typically through recognized tests or prior qualifications.
  6. Commitment to Learning: Enthusiasm for hands-on learning and a willingness to adhere to professional standards and practices is essential.

To achieve this qualification a learner must successfully complete a minimum of five units, which must include all four mandatory units and at least one other unit selected from the optional units of 62-65 credits.

Mandatory Units – Candidates must complete all units in this group

  • In-Depth Anatomy and Physiology for Beauty Therapies (Credits: 7)
  • Comprehensive Health, Safety, and Hygiene Protocols in Beauty Treatments (Credits: 6)
  • Professional Client Consultation and Tailored Treatment Planning (Credits: 7)
  • Advanced Techniques in Facial Skincare Treatments (Credits: 10)

Optional Units – Candidates must complete a selection of units in this group

  • Manicure Techniques for Professional Results (Credits: 6)
  • Pedicure Techniques for Optimal Foot Care (Credits: 6)
  • Advanced Waxing Techniques for Smooth, Long-Lasting Results (Credits: 8)
  • Lash and Brow Enhancement: Shaping and Tinting Techniques (Credits: 6)
  • Expert Makeup Application for Various Occasions (Credits: 6)
  • UV Gel Nail Services: Application and Aftercare (Credits: 6)
  • Essential Business Support for Beauty Therapists (Credits: 6)
  • Offering Expert Advice on Beauty Products and Services (Credits: 6)
  • Best Practices for Freelance Beauty Therapists (Credits: 6)
  • Effective Promotional Strategies and Marketing for Beauty Professionals (Credits: 9)
  • Professional treatments of Threading (Credits: 6)

Learning Outcomes of the 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ments:

Mandatory Units

In-Depth Anatomy and Physiology for Beauty Therapies

  • Gain an advanced understanding of human anatomy and physiology relevant to beauty therapies.
  • Learn about the structure and function of the skin, muscles, bones, circulatory system, and nervous system, focusing on how these systems are affected by various beauty treatments.
  • Apply knowledge of body systems to assess clients and determine the most suitable beauty treatments for individual needs.
  • Understand the impact of treatments such as facials, massage, and hair removal on the body’s physiological processes.
  • Use this knowledge to inform treatment planning and ensure client safety and well-being.

Comprehensive Health, Safety, and Hygiene Protocols in Beauty Treatments

  • Implement health, safety, and hygiene protocols in a beauty therapy setting, ensuring a clean, safe, and hygienic environment.
  • Follow sterilization and sanitation procedures to prevent infection and cross-contamination between clients and professionals.
  • Identify and manage potential hazards within a beauty treatment environment, taking proactive measures to ensure the safety of both the client and therapist.
  • Educate clients on health and safety measures, including post-treatment care and potential reactions.
  • Maintain a high standard of personal hygiene and salon cleanliness to comply with regulatory standards.

Professional Client Consultation and Tailored Treatment Planning

  • Conduct professional consultations with clients to understand their beauty needs, preferences, and medical history.
  • Assess clients’ skin types, hair conditions, and overall health to recommend the most appropriate beauty treatments.
  • Provide personalized treatment plans that cater to individual client goals, ensuring both effectiveness and safety.
  • Communicate clearly with clients to set realistic expectations for treatment outcomes and explain the benefits, risks, and aftercare procedures.
  • Keep detailed client records to track treatment progress, preferences, and any changes to their beauty needs.

Advanced Techniques in Facial Skincare Treatments

  • Master advanced techniques for facial treatments, including exfoliation, cleansing, toning, mask application, and facial massage.
  • Learn how to identify and treat various skin concerns, such as acne, hyperpigmentation, aging, and dehydration, using advanced skincare products and technologies.
  • Tailor facial treatments to suit different skin types and conditions, ensuring a customized approach for each client.
  • Stay up-to-date with the latest advancements in facial skincare products, tools, and equipment to provide cutting-edge treatments.
  • Advise clients on the best skincare routines for maintaining healthy skin between treatments.

Even if a centre is already registered with ICTQual AB, it must meet specific requirements to deliver the 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ments. These standards ensure the quality and consistency of training, assessment, and learner support.

1. Approval to Deliver the Qualification

  • Centres must obtain formal approval from ICTQual AB to deliver this specific qualification, even if they are already registered.
  • The approval process includes a review of resources, staff qualifications, and policies relevant to the program.

2. Qualified Staff

  • Tutors: Must hold a Level 2 or higher qualification in Beauty Treatments. Must possess a teaching or training qualification (e.g., Level 3 Award in Education and Training). Should demonstrate recent industry experience in beauty treatments such as facials, waxing, basic makeup application, and hand and foot care.
  • Assessors: Must hold a recognized assessor qualification (e.g., Level 3 Certificate in Assessing Vocational Achievement). Should have practical expertise in all Level 2 beauty treatment techniques, including customer consultation, treatment application, and aftercare.
  • Internal Quality Assurers (IQAs): Must hold a relevant IQA qualification and have experience monitoring beauty treatment assessments.

3. Learning Facilities

Centres must have access to appropriate learning facilities, which include:

  • Classrooms: Equipped with modern technology for theoretical training, including anatomy, hygiene, skin analysis, and client care.
  • Practical Areas: Professional beauty therapy suites featuring: Treatment couches and ergonomic workstations. Equipment for facials, waxing, hand and foot care, and makeup application. Proper lighting and ventilation for precise and hygienic treatment delivery.
  • Technology Access: E-learning platforms and multimedia tools to support blended or remote learning.

4. Health and Safety Compliance

  • Centres must ensure that practical training environments comply with relevant health and safety regulations.
  • Risk assessments must be conducted regularly to maintain a safe learning environment.

5. Resource Requirements

  • Learning Materials: Approved course manuals, textbooks, and study guides aligned with the curriculum.
  • Assessment Tools: Templates, guidelines, and resources for conducting and recording assessments.
  • E-Learning Systems: If offering online or hybrid learning, centres must provide a robust Learning Management System (LMS) to facilitate remote delivery.

6. Assessment and Quality Assurance

  • Centres must adhere to ICTQual’s assessment standards, ensuring that all assessments are fair, valid, and reliable.
  • Internal quality assurance (IQA) processes must be in place to monitor assessments and provide feedback to assessors.
  • External verification visits from ICTQual will ensure compliance with awarding body standards.

7. Learner Support

  • Centres must provide learners with access to guidance and support throughout the program, including:
    • Academic support for coursework.
    • Career guidance for future progression.
    • Additional support for learners with specific needs (e.g., disabilities or language barriers).

8. Policies and Procedures

Centres must maintain and implement the following policies, as required by ICTQual:

  • Equal Opportunities Policy.
  • Health and Safety Policy.
  • Complaints and Appeals Procedure.
  • Data Protection and Confidentiality Policy.

9. Regular Reporting to ICTQual

  • Centres must provide regular updates to ICTQual AB on learner enrollment, progress, and completion rates.
  • Centres are required to maintain records of assessments and learner achievements for external auditing purposes.

Route for Candidates with No Experience

This route is ideal for learners who are new to the Beauty Treatments field and do not have prior work experience. The process is as follows:

  • Admission: The candidate enrolls in the program at an ICTQual Approved Training Centre.
  • Training: The learner undergoes formal training, covering all the essential study units. Training will include both theoretical instruction and practical activities.
  • Assessment: Learners will be required to complete and submit assignments based on the course’s learning outcomes. These assignments will test the learner’s understanding and application of the course material.
  • Certification: After successfully completing the required assignments and assessments, the learner will be awarded the 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ments.

Route for Experienced and Competent Candidates

For candidates who already have relevant work experience in Hairdressing, the following route is available:

  • Eligibility: The candidate must have at least 2 years of verified experience in Beauty Treatments or a related field. This experience must be relevant to the learning outcomes of the qualification.
  • Assessment of Competence: The candidate does not need to undergo the full training program. Instead, the ICTQual Approved Training Centre will assess whether the candidate’s existing knowledge and skills align with the learning outcomes of the course.
  • Evidence Submission: The candidate must submit documentation and evidence of their work experience to demonstrate competence in the required areas. This can include job roles, responsibilities, and tasks performed that align with the learning outcomes of the course.
  • Knowledge and Understanding: Centres must ensure that the candidate is familiar with all the course’s learning outcomes. If necessary, a skills gap assessment may be conducted to determine if any additional learning is required.
  • Certification: Upon successful verification of experience and competence, the candidate will be awarded the 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ments without having to complete the full training course.

Both routes ensure that candidates either gain the necessary knowledge through training or demonstrate their existing competency to achieve the ICTQual Level 2 Diploma in Beauty Treatments. This flexible approach caters to both new learners and experienced professionals seeking formal certification.
